Dose of magnesium supplements for knee pain. The recommended dietary allowance of magnesium varies depending on your gender, age, and overall health. For people without medical conditions the recommended intake is ( 6 ): For males, 400-420 mg daily depending on the age. For females, 310-320 mg daily depending on the age.

In studies, proprietary extracts of Boswellia serrata (5-Loxin, Aflapin) temporarily reduced inflammation and pain and disability in knee OA. A systematic review found noteworthy effects in easing OA symptoms, although the quality of the evidence was weak.
